如何使用Maven创建Hadoop2项目

2023-04-16 13:20:00 创建 项目 如何使用

Maven是一个用于构建和管理Java项目的构建工具。它可以帮助开发人员更轻松地构建和管理他们的项目,而不需要担心依赖关系、依赖管理或者配置管理。Maven也可以用于构建Hadoop2项目。本文将介绍如何使用Maven构建Hadoop2项目。

首先,需要在计算机上安装Maven,可以从官网下载最新版本的Maven,并安装在计算机上。安装完成后,需要确保Maven的环境变量配置正确,以便在命令行中使用Maven命令。

接下来,需要准备一个新的Maven项目,可以使用Maven提供的archetype模板来快速创建项目,也可以手动创建项目。首先,在命令行中使用Maven命令创建一个新的Maven项目:

mvn archetype:generate -DgroupId=com.example.hadoop -DartifactId=hadoop-project -DarchetypeArtifactId=maven-archetype-quickstart -DinteractiveMode=false

这将创建一个名为hadoop-project的Maven项目,其中groupId为com.example.hadoop,artifactId为hadoop-project。

接下来,需要在项目中添加Hadoop2的依赖,在项目的pom.xml文件中添加如下内容:

<dependency>
    <groupId>org.apache.hadoop</groupId>
    <artifactId>hadoop-client</artifactId>
    <version>2.7.3</version>
</dependency>

这将添加Hadoop2的依赖,并且可以在项目中使用Hadoop2的API。

接下来,需要在项目中添加Hadoop2的配置文件,可以从Hadoop官网下载最新版本的Hadoop2的配置文件,将其解压缩到项目的根目录中,并将其添加到项目中,以便在项目中使用Hadoop2的配置文件。

最后,需要在项目中添加Hadoop2的库文件,可以从Hadoop官网下载最新版本的Hadoop2的库文件,将其解压缩到项目的根目录中,并将其添加到项目中,以便在项目中使用Hadoop2的库文件。

最后,需要使用Maven命令构建Hadoop2项目,可以在命令行中使用如下命令构建项目:

mvn clean package

这将清理项目,并将其打包成可执行的jar文件,以便在Hadoop集群上运行。

通过以上步骤,可以使用Maven构建Hadoop2项目。Maven可以帮助开发人员更轻松地构建和管理他们的项目,而不需要担心依赖关系、依赖管理或者配置管理。

相关文章